Breath of the Wild (BotW), undoubtedly one of the highest-rated games of all times, boasts of its unique mechanics that have changed the way we approach open-world games. The game has taken the gaming industry by storm and has remained an all-time favorite for many players. However, what engine does BotW use? Have you ever wondered about the technology that powers the game’s beautiful graphics and seamless gameplay? In this article, we will delve into the game’s graphics engine, and you’ll be surprised at what you’ll learn!
BotW runs on the “Custom Nintendo Switch’s game engine,” which was designed explicitly for the switch. Nintendo’s development team made it in-house, which gives BotW a unique and impressive approach to gameplay mechanics. The switch engine is an engine that has been optimized to deliver high-definition graphics, bringing the game to life on your screen while at the same time delivering a seamless playing experience. The engine is a customized version of Nintendo’s original game engine, which has been a backbone for many of their notable games.
Additionally, the switch engine features a new feature known as “Forgotten Tech.” This feature was specifically built for BotW to take advantage of the unique hybrid nature of the Nintendo Switch. With Forgotten Tech, BotW can switch without stutter or delay between the game’s two graphics modes, allowing gamers to switch between handheld and docked mode without losing any game progress. All these features make BotW one of the most immersive games out there, with a game engine that takes gaming experience to new heights. Now you know what engine powers your favorite game, and we hope you’ll enjoy playing it even more!
BotW Game Engine Overview
Developed by Nintendo, The Legend of Zelda: Breath of the Wild (BotW) is an action-adventure game played on the Nintendo Switch and Wii U consoles. The game engine used for BotW is unique to the series and was built from the ground up, instead of using an existing one. The engine is called the “Breath Engine,” and it was created to provide players with an immersive and open-world gaming experience.
Features of the Breath Engine
- The engine uses a complex physics system that simulates realistic interactions between objects and characters. For instance, players can chop down trees, set them on fire, and watch them fall on enemies.
- The Breath Engine renders the game world in real-time, allowing for seamless transitions between different areas and weather conditions. It also supports a day and night cycle, with dynamic lighting and shadows that change based on the time of day.
- The engine uses a procedural generation system for terrain and landscape, which creates a unique and organic environment for players to explore. The development team created a system called “Scrapple,” which randomly generates terrain features such as mountains, cliffs, and valleys.
The Role of Shaders in the Breath Engine
Shaders are fundamental to the visual effects of the Breath Engine. They are small programs that run on the graphics processing unit (GPU) and are responsible for rendering graphics, including textures, shadows, and lighting. The “Breath of the Wild” uses a technique called cel-shading, which creates a cartoon-like appearance with bold outlines and flat areas of color. This approach gives the game a unique look that sets it apart from other open-world games.
Conclusion
The “Breath Engine” used to develop The Legend of Zelda: Breath of the Wild is an impressive piece of technology that delivers a truly immersive gaming experience. With its sophisticated physics system, dynamic lighting and weather effects, and procedural generation system, the Breath Engine creates a world that feels organic and alive. The use of shaders and cel-shading techniques further enhances the game’s unique visual style. Players of the game are in for a thrilling journey through the vast and compelling landscape of Hyrule.
Features | Description |
---|---|
Complex Physics System | Simulates realistic interactions between objects and characters |
Procedural Generation System | Randomly generates terrain features such as mountains, cliffs, and valleys |
Cel-Shading | Creates a cartoon-like appearance with bold outlines and flat areas of color |
Sources: Nintendo, PC Gamer, IGN
BotW Game Development Tools
Creating a massive open-world game like The Legend of Zelda: Breath of the Wild requires a variety of game development tools. Let’s take a look at some of the tools that were utilized during the creation of the game.
Game Engines
- One of the key elements of any game development project is the game engine. For The Legend of Zelda: Breath of the Wild, Nintendo used a custom game engine called the “Nintendo Switch Development Kit.” This engine was designed specifically for the Nintendo Switch console, allowing the game’s developers to optimize performance and take advantage of the console’s unique features.
- In addition to the custom engine, Nintendo also utilized the Havok Physics engine for the game’s physics simulations. Havok is a popular physics engine used in many games, and it allowed the developers to create realistic interactions between objects in the game world.
- To create realistic and dynamic lighting in the game, Nintendo used the LightWave 3D software. This tool allowed the team to create and manipulate lighting in real-time, resulting in an immersive and visually stunning open world.
Development Software
In addition to game engines, the development team also utilized a variety of software tools to achieve their vision for the game.
- The Unity game engine was used for creating the game’s user interface and menus. This engine is particularly well-suited to creating these types of elements, and helped the developers to create a simple and intuitive interface for players to navigate.
- To create the game’s audio, the development team used Audiokinetic’s Wwise software. This tool allowed the team to create complex audio systems that responded dynamically to player actions and environmental factors like weather and time of day.
- Finally, the team used the Substance Painter software for creating the game’s textures and materials. This software allowed the team to create high-quality, realistic textures that really brought the game world to life.
Artificial Intelligence
One of the unique features of The Legend of Zelda: Breath of the Wild is the game’s wide range of AI behaviors. The game’s developers utilized a custom AI system to create this behavior, which allowed them to create realistic and varied interactions between AI-controlled characters and the player.
AI Behaviors | Description |
---|---|
Enemy AI | The game’s enemies exhibit different behaviors depending on the time of day, their surroundings, and their health. Some enemies may be more aggressive at night, while others may flee if they are injured. |
Animal AI | The game’s animals exhibit realistic behavior, such as grazing or fleeing when they sense danger. Different animals also interact differently with each other, such as predators hunting prey. |
NPC AI | The game’s non-playable characters have unique routines that they follow based on the time of day and their daily schedule. Some NPCs may also react differently to the player depending on their reputation and previous interactions. |
The AI system in The Legend of Zelda: Breath of the Wild helped to create a dynamic and immersive open world that felt truly alive.
BotW Physics Engine
The Breath of the Wild (BotW) game has impressed many with its advanced graphics, open-world gameplay, and intelligent design. One area where the game truly excels is in its physics engine. The game’s physics engine operates seamlessly with the environment, allowing players to manipulate objects, solve puzzles, and fight enemies with a degree of realism and accuracy that is not usually seen in video games.
- Realistic Physics: The BotW physics engine simulates real-world physics, including gravity, friction, momentum, and collision detection. This means that objects in the game world behave realistically, and their interactions with other objects and the environment are consistent with what we would expect in real life.
- Manipulating Objects: Players can manipulate objects in the game world, such as boulders, boxes, and metal objects, using a magnesis ability. This ability allows players to pick up, move, and throw objects with a degree of control that feels natural and intuitive.
- Puzzle Solving: The game’s physics engine is used extensively in puzzles, where players must use their knowledge of physics to solve challenges. For example, players may need to use a ball to trigger a switch, or use a metal object to complete an electrical circuit.
The BotW physics engine also plays a crucial role in combat. The game’s combat system is built around physics, allowing players to use their environment and manipulate objects to defeat enemies. For example, players may use a metal object as a shield to deflect incoming attacks, or use a bomb to blow up a group of enemies.
The following table outlines some of the key features of the BotW physics engine:
Feature | Description |
---|---|
Realistic physics | The physics engine simulates real-world physics, including gravity, friction, momentum, and collision detection. |
Magnesis ability | Allows players to pick up, move, and throw objects with a degree of control that feels natural and intuitive. |
Puzzle solving | The physics engine is used extensively in puzzles, where players must use their knowledge of physics to solve challenges. |
Combat system | The game’s combat system is built around physics, allowing players to use their environment and manipulate objects to defeat enemies. |
In conclusion, the BotW physics engine is a standout feature of the game, allowing players to interact with the game world in realistic and intuitive ways. The engine’s ability to simulate real-world physics, as well as its use in puzzles and combat, is a testament to the skill and expertise of the game’s developers.
BotW Renderer Engine
The Breath of the Wild Renderer Engine is responsible for rendering all the graphics that you see in the game; this includes every single detail such as the characters, environments, items, and everything else. The engine uses various complex algorithms to create a seamless and immersive gameplay experience, allowing players to fully immerse themselves in the world of Hyrule.
Key Features of BotW Renderer Engine
- Advanced Lighting Techniques: The game’s advanced lighting techniques create a realistic and dynamic environment, with realistic shadows, reflections and depth of field.
- Particle Effects: The engine allows for stunning particle effects, enhancing the game’s aesthetics.
- High-Quality Textures: The game uses high-quality textures, which are essential to creating a detailed and immersive world.
Nintendo’s Custom Engine
The Breath of the Wild Renderer Engine was developed in-house by Nintendo, specifically for the game. This custom engine allowed the developers to create a world that feels alive and dynamic, as well as providing a smooth gameplay experience. The engine was designed to take full advantage of the Switch hardware, enabling the game to run smoothly even in split-screen multiplayer mode. It is also worth mentioning that the engine allows for full-time shader compilation on the Switch while the game is running, allowing for a much smoother gameplay experience.
Technical Details of the Engine
The engine is built on top of the Havok physics engine, and it uses the OpenGL graphics API to render the game’s graphics. It is also worth noting that the engine uses a physically-based shading system, which allows for highly realistic and accurate lighting and shadows. The table below provides a breakdown of the technical details of the engine:
Engine Name | Breath of the Wild Renderer Engine |
---|---|
Physics Engine | Havok Physics Engine |
Graphics API | OpenGL |
Shading Model | Physically-Based Shading |
In conclusion, the Breath of the Wild Renderer Engine is a highly advanced and custom-built game engine that allowed the developers to create a game that has truly captured the hearts of gamers all around the world. The engine’s highly advanced lighting techniques, particle effects, and high-quality textures all work together to create a world that feels alive and dynamic, immersing players in the magical world of Hyrule.
BotW Audio Engine
The audio engine for Breath of the Wild is a complex system designed to create a rich immersive experience for players. The engine is responsible for handling all the audio in the game, including sound effects, music, and dialogue. The audio engine works in conjunction with the game engine to create a seamless experience for the player.
Features of the Audio Engine
- The audio engine is capable of playing multiple sounds at the same time, with no lag or delay
- It can adjust the volume of individual sounds based on their position in 3D space, creating a realistic surround sound experience
- The engine supports dynamic music, which can change seamlessly based on the player’s actions and the environment around them
Sound Design in Breath of the Wild
The sound design in Breath of the Wild is one of the game’s strongest features. The audio team spent countless hours creating unique sound profiles for each of the game’s environments, creatures and characters. They also utilized a technique called Foley recording, which involves recording natural sounds to create sound effects for in-game objects and characters. This attention to detail makes the game feel more immersive and realistic.
The game’s music was also approached in a unique way. The team used a combination of live musicians and synthesized instruments to create a score that is both epic and organic. The music is also used sparingly, with long stretches of silence punctuated by the occasional burst of music, creating an atmosphere of isolation and tension.
The Role of the Audio Engine in the Game’s Development
The audio engine played a critical role in the development of Breath of the Wild. It allowed the audio team to create an immersive soundscape that enhances the player’s experience. The engine allowed for a level of sound design that was not possible in previous Zelda games, allowing players to feel fully immersed in the game’s world.
Advantages of the Audio Engine | Disadvantages of the Audio Engine |
---|---|
Allows for dynamic music that changes based on the player’s actions | The audio engine is complex and requires a lot of resources to run |
Can adjust the volume of individual sounds based on 3D space | Can be difficult to implement in games with large open worlds |
Supports real-time sound effects | Requires experienced sound designers to create immersive soundscapes |
Overall, the audio engine in Breath of the Wild is one of the game’s strongest features, providing a rich soundscape that enhances the player’s experience. Its dynamic music, real-time sound effects, and ability to adjust the volume of individual sounds based on their position in 3D space make it a valuable tool for game developers looking to create immersive worlds.
BotW Lighting Engine
One of the most impressive features of Breath of The Wild is its lighting system. The game uses a dynamic, real-time lighting engine that makes the world feel alive and reactive to the changing environments.
- The lighting engine is based on a system called “Light Probes,” which are invisible objects placed throughout the game world.
- These probes capture the lighting information from their surrounding area and save it for later use.
- When an object enters the area of a probe, the game looks up the saved data to calculate how much light should be bouncing off the object based on the surrounding environment.
This allows for incredibly realistic lighting effects to be created on the fly without needing to pre-render the lighting for every possible scene in the game.
Additionally, the game also uses soft shadows, making the entire world feel more immersive and natural. The objects in the game receive shadows based on the position and angle of the light source, giving them a sense of depth and weight.
All of these factors combined make the lighting in Breath of The Wild one of its standout features, creating a truly beautiful and immersive game world.
Below is a table summarizing the key points of the BotW lighting engine:
Feature | Description |
---|---|
Light Probes | Invisible objects that capture lighting information from their surrounding area |
Real-time lighting | Lighting effects are calculated on the fly, making scenes feel dynamic and reactive |
Soft shadows | Objects receive shadows based on the position and angle of the light source |
BotW AI Engine
The Legend of Zelda: Breath of the Wild (BotW) has been a hit among gaming enthusiasts for its expansive open world, engaging gameplay, and impressive visual graph. But, it’s not just the graphics that make BotW stand out, the game’s AI Engine is one of the most impressive features of the game’s development. This enhanced AI is particularly notable for how it contributes to immersion and how it creates a world that feels alive.
- The AI Engine is designed to make characters more human-like. Characters in BotW have moods and personalities, which change based on various factors such as time of day, weather, and player behavior. For instance, if you visit a character at their home in the middle of the night, they are more likely to be grumpy or asleep than they would if you visited them during the day.
- The AI Engine makes characters interact with each other more naturally. For example, if a monster attacks a town, the NPCs in that town will flee or fight back. If you leave a weapon out in the open, a character passing by may pick it up and use it.
- The AI Engine constantly learns from the player’s behavior. If you spend most of your time cooking, chopping wood, and collecting food, the AI will take this into account. The game will stock up on specific items, making it easier for you to progress in the game without having to backtrack to collect resources.
Furthermore, the game’s environment plays a crucial role in the AI Engine’s behavior. Weather plays a significant role in the game, and the AI Engine’s behavior changes based on the environmental output. For example, let’s say you are climbing a mountain during a thunderstorm. The AI Engine will increase the chance of you being struck by lightning. When the weather changes, new opportunities become available, such as starting a fire or exploring new parts of the map.
Lastly, let’s take a look at the technical details of the engine under the hood. The CPU and GPU work together to keep the game running without hiccups. Developers used a dual-core Cortex-A57 and quad-core Cortex-A53 processors, running at a speed of 1.2GHz. The Wii U version of the game runs at 720p, while the Switch version boasts 900p.
Platform | Resolution | Frame Rate |
---|---|---|
Wii U | 720p | ~20-30fps |
Nintendo Switch Docked | 900p | ~30fps |
Nintendo Switch Handheld | 720p | ~30fps |
In conclusion, The AI Engine in The Legend of Zelda: Breath of the Wild is a significant achievement in gaming technology. The engine brings a level of realism, interactivity and immersion that makes BotW unique and enjoyable. It’s clear that the engine is one of the reasons why this game holds up as one of the best open-world games to date.
FAQs: What Engine Does Botw Use?
1. What engine does Botw use?
Botw, also known as The Legend of Zelda: Breath of the Wild, uses the custom-made engine created by Nintendo, called the “Nintendo Switch Development Environment.”
2. Can the engine be used for other games?
The Nintendo Switch Development Environment is designed specifically for games on the Nintendo Switch, so it cannot be used for other games on other platforms.
3. What are the capabilities of the engine?
The engine allows for seamless open-world exploration, dynamic lighting and shadow effects, physics-based gameplay, and weather and climate changes.
4. Was this Nintendo’s first custom-made engine?
No, Nintendo has created custom engines for previous consoles, such as the Wii U and the Nintendo 3DS.
5. Are there any drawbacks to using the Nintendo Switch Development Environment?
One potential drawback is that it may require more powerful hardware as it pushes the limits of the Nintendo Switch’s capabilities.
6. Is the engine available for public use?
No, the Nintendo Switch Development Environment is not available for public use as it is proprietary software owned by Nintendo.
7. Does the engine contribute to the game’s success?
Yes, the engine plays a significant role in the game’s success. The engine allows for an immersive gameplay experience, making the game world feel more realistic and dynamic.
Closing Paragraph: Thanks for Visiting
Thank you for reading about what engine does Botw use. We hope this article has provided you with helpful information about the game and its development. Be sure to check back for more informative articles on gaming and technology.